    About Ksawera

    Ksawera offers a truly distinctive choice for parents drawn to names with a rich, classic heritage but seeking something far less common. With its roots in Basque and Latin, meaning "new house" and evoking a sense of brightness and splendor, Ksawera carries an elegant and distinguished air. This is a name for those who appreciate a connection to early Christian traditions, yet desire a name that stands apart from more familiar Biblical choices. Unlike many classic names, Ksawera's unique phonetic spelling — starting with the 'Ks' sound — ensures it's both memorable and a conversation starter, perfect for a child destined to shine brightly and make her own mark. It’s a name that feels both ancient and refreshingly new.
